After our POA cruise, our Hawaiian Airlines flight has been changed to 1½ hours later, departing now at 2.30pm.

 

Since it seems we have to be off the ship by 9.30 or thereabouts, what can we do between then and 12.30 when we check in at the airport.

 

It's not long enough for any tour, but we really don't want to sit in the airport for 3 hours with luggage.

 

Is there anywhere interesting to stop en route to the airport, or even a nice café/restaurant with pleasant views?

You could do a post-cruise excursion. Our flight left at 3:30 p.m. and we did the early bird Pearl Harbor excursion through NCL. It worked out very well. We were at Pearl Harbor just shy of 3 hrs and at the airport by 12 noon. Our luggage came with us on the bus.

Well...if it were me I would be thrilled with the extra time. And...I would head to the beach in front of the Outrigger Waikiki, rent an umbrella and 2 chairs, enjoy swimming in Waikiki, and a last mai tai and burger at Dukes. We often order take-out at Dukes bar. It's great. There is a shower to rinse off and you can easily change clothes. Hope this helps. Cherie And, I think that you can check your luggage with the bell desk.
